Bill Maher, the US comedian and TV show host, said the Nigerian terror group Boko Haram has “killed over 100,000 [Christians] since 2009”, “burned 18,000 churches” and is “literally attempting to wipe out the Christian population of an entire country”. But it’s “unclear where Maher got his figures from”, said Al Jazeera.
